Block 507,518
Block Hash
52eaec71f907cbf47a69642c153d194e45776b7f05a9a7878481526462a7bb2d
Previous Block Hash
9139cc84d8fbe8e8f3570fa7f0821cd0d3c9c5e8e71e980d1b9d84afaf0c7373
Mined
Transactions
2
Difficulty
36.89 M
Size
839 bytes
Transactions (2)
1 input, 1 output
15,625.067
PEPE
4 inputs, 2 outputs
1,954,658.65930433
PEPE